How to apply for a visitor visa

Note: You'll find the forms and guides you need on the right side of the page

1. Complete the form(s)

Complete the Visitor Visa Application (INZ 1017) PDF [536KB].

 

If you are located in the Auckland region and need a visitor visa, use the Visitor Visa Application for Auckland Region Applicants (INZ 1111) PDF [258KB], or

Partnership-based visitor visa applications

If you are applying for a visitor visa on the basis of your partnership with someone who is already in New Zealand, complete the  Partnership-based Temporary Visa Application (INZ 1198) PDF [653KB].

 

Your partner must also complete a Form for partners supporting partnership-based temporary entry applications (INZ 1146) PDF [236KB].

Useful guides

For help completing the forms, see the Visitor Visa Guide (INZ 1018) PDF [376KB] or the Partnership-based Temporary Visa Guide (INZ 1199) PDF [639KB].

2. If you need one, get a medical certificate

If you intend to be in New Zealand for more than six months, you may also need to provide a completed Chest X-ray Certificate (INZ 1096) PDF [557KB]. Check if you need to.

 

If you intend to be in New Zealand for more than one year, you will need to provide a completed General Medical Certificate (INZ 1007) PDF [480KB] and Chest X-ray Certificate (INZ 1096) PDF [557KB]. If you have already provided these certificates within the last 36 months you may not need to provide new certificates.

 

For full details on our health requirements, see our leaflet Health Requirements (INZ 1121) PDF [161KB].

3. Provide all the information requested

To ensure your application is accepted, provide all information required in the checklist on your application form along with the correct fee.

 

Note: Many of our branches provide checklists with local requirements on their branch web pages.

 

4. Lodge your application

If you are overseas, your application must be approved before you travel to New Zealand. Find out where to send your application.

 

If you are applying for a visitor visa and you are in the Auckland region, your application must be sent to:

 

Immigration New Zealand
PO Box 76895
Auckland Mail Centre

 

If you elsewhere in New Zealand, you must send your application to your nearest Immigration New Zealand branch.
